He liberated the element by passing chlorine … Web21 mei 2024 · Rhodium was discovered in 1803 by English chemist William Hyde Wollaston. Wollaston found it while studying a sample of platinum ore. Rhodium is named after the Greek word for rose, rhodon. This is because of its rose-like colour. Rhodium is found in South Africa, Russia, and North America.
